.avia-section.av-kqvgo5e-4252e65157110ecad58c2e3991c49ed9{
background-color:#ffffff;
background-image:unset;
}

#top .avia_search_element.av-1yyxqg2-a887597ec4fc6c302f248d5318d51b4f .av_searchform_wrapper{
border-radius:20px 20px 20px 20px;
}
#top .avia_search_element.av-1yyxqg2-a887597ec4fc6c302f248d5318d51b4f #s.av-input-field{
border-radius:20px 20px 20px 20px;
color:#76a1cf;
}
#top .avia_search_element.av-1yyxqg2-a887597ec4fc6c302f248d5318d51b4f .av-input-field-icon.av-search-icon{
color:#76a1cf;
}
#top .avia_search_element.av-1yyxqg2-a887597ec4fc6c302f248d5318d51b4f .av_searchsubmit_wrapper{
border-radius:20px 20px 20px 20px;
color:#ffffff;
background-color:#587fb0;
}
#top .avia_search_element.av-1yyxqg2-a887597ec4fc6c302f248d5318d51b4f #searchsubmit{
border-radius:20px 20px 20px 20px;
color:#ffffff;
background-color:#587fb0;
}

.flex_cell.av-idb6boi-4f8d589eabb03b5c50265a9b8e6dc526{
vertical-align:top;
background-color:#ffffff;
}
.responsive #top #wrap_all .flex_cell.av-idb6boi-4f8d589eabb03b5c50265a9b8e6dc526{
padding:0 0 2% 0 !important;
}

#top .avia-gallery.av-mhijs9af-edd41d7c9d1b25bcd63764b426ceb58a .avia-gallery-thumb a{
width:20%;
}

.flex_cell.av-1oxjm8y-49d704286a62b69fc673d6a1c2bc7627{
vertical-align:top;
background-color:#ffffff;
}

#top .av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922{
padding-bottom:10px;
color:#000000;
font-size:30px;
}
body .av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922 .av-special-heading-tag{
font-size:30px;
}
.av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922 .special-heading-inner-border{
border-color:#000000;
}
.av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-mhijuu6a-5666bf8b64307147e397b3fe72757b7f .avia_textblock{
font-size:16px;
color:#000000;
text-align:left;
}

#top #wrap_all .avia-button.av-g1yb7b6-1e3340d9946b72d94375a93229b976bf{
font-size:16px;
background-color:#f39000;
border-color:#f39000;
color:#ffffff;
border-radius:40px 40px 40px 40px;
transition:all 0.4s ease-in-out;
margin:10% 4% 0 0;
padding:4% 8% 4% 8%;
}
#top #wrap_all.avia-button.av-g1yb7b6-1e3340d9946b72d94375a93229b976bf:hover .avia_button_background{
border-radius:40px 40px 40px 40px;
}

#top #wrap_all .avia-button.av-1j917ya-664f486986771d6fd27170f07baade6f{
font-size:16px;
background-color:#004a98;
border-color:#004a98;
color:#ffffff;
border-radius:40px 40px 40px 40px;
transition:all 0.4s ease-in-out;
margin:10% 0 0 0;
padding:4% 8% 4% 8%;
}
#top #wrap_all.avia-button.av-1j917ya-664f486986771d6fd27170f07baade6f:hover .avia_button_background{
border-radius:40px 40px 40px 40px;
}

.avia-section.av-efpgnvm-0b566884faeaec7c6daa34990b28fce6{
background-color:#efefef;
background-image:unset;
}

#top .flex_column.av-dvxc37m-64c1b20568a39dee3a98f02d893578e8{
margin-top:0;
margin-bottom:0;
}
.flex_column.av-dvxc37m-64c1b20568a39dee3a98f02d893578e8{
padding:0 0 2% 0;
}
.responsive #top #wrap_all .flex_column.av-dvxc37m-64c1b20568a39dee3a98f02d893578e8{
margin-top:0;
margin-bottom:0;
}

#top .av-special-heading.av-doaotuq-0d795f8d14ca077c9ea76c677c4d693b{
margin:0 0 0 0;
padding-bottom:0;
font-size:40px;
}
body .av-special-heading.av-doaotuq-0d795f8d14ca077c9ea76c677c4d693b .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-doaotuq-0d795f8d14ca077c9ea76c677c4d693b .av-special-heading-tag{
font-size:40px;
padding:0 0 0 0;
}
.av-special-heading.av-doaotuq-0d795f8d14ca077c9ea76c677c4d693b .av-subheading{
font-size:15px;
}

#top .flex_column.av-cx2vrlu-3ca106e34ca56637838c3b23f36e4aae{
margin-top:0;
margin-bottom:0;
}
.flex_column.av-cx2vrlu-3ca106e34ca56637838c3b23f36e4aae{
padding:2% 2% 2% 2%;
background-color:#f7f7f7;
}
.responsive #top #wrap_all .flex_column.av-cx2vrlu-3ca106e34ca56637838c3b23f36e4aae{
margin-top:0;
margin-bottom:0;
}

#top .av_textblock_section.av-mhijwg6m-aee67b165ee5edb33e912762fc2b33f4 .avia_textblock{
font-size:16px;
color:#1d1d1f;
text-align:left;
}

.avia-section.av-193h2iq-d4ad8d94fd8b568aca56f452246e9309{
background-color:#f7f7f7;
background-image:unset;
}

#top .flex_column.av-cb2utk2-ad2ade1e928c071b081516d661063779{
margin-top:0;
margin-bottom:0;
}
.flex_column.av-cb2utk2-ad2ade1e928c071b081516d661063779{
padding:0 0 2% 0;
}
.responsive #top #wrap_all .flex_column.av-cb2utk2-ad2ade1e928c071b081516d661063779{
margin-top:0;
margin-bottom:0;
}

#top .av-special-heading.av-bl8n602-3a7087f89e59e508e882631d7349b89b{
margin:0 0 0 0;
padding-bottom:0;
font-size:40px;
}
body .av-special-heading.av-bl8n602-3a7087f89e59e508e882631d7349b89b .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-bl8n602-3a7087f89e59e508e882631d7349b89b .av-special-heading-tag{
font-size:40px;
padding:0 0 0 0;
}
.av-special-heading.av-bl8n602-3a7087f89e59e508e882631d7349b89b .av-subheading{
font-size:15px;
}

#top .flex_column.av-bffo0o2-c3bcdac7b43747cfa1cbaf6d535c94eb{
margin-top:0;
margin-bottom:0;
}
.flex_column.av-bffo0o2-c3bcdac7b43747cfa1cbaf6d535c94eb{
padding:2% 2% 2% 2%;
background-color:#ffffff;
}
.responsive #top #wrap_all .flex_column.av-bffo0o2-c3bcdac7b43747cfa1cbaf6d535c94eb{
margin-top:0;
margin-bottom:0;
}

#top .av_textblock_section.av-mhijwz6v-0e98edd6c5b5a26d848e566cc85ce4b3 .avia_textblock{
font-size:16px;
color:#1d1d1f;
text-align:left;
}

.flex_column.av-a9zllj6-a738127c7fb3dbb64133822eee63c14d{
border-radius:30px 30px 30px 30px;
padding:4% 3% 4% 3%;
background-color:rgba(120,120,120,0.43);
}
.avia_transform .flex_column.av-a9zllj6-a738127c7fb3dbb64133822eee63c14d{
animation-duration:2.5s;
}

#top .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192{
padding-bottom:10px;
color:#ffffff;
font-size:45px;
}
body .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-special-heading-tag{
font-size:45px;
}
.av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-yn2tvm-18cdaf6ad1d01e71ae4f3aba7815fb7f .avia_textblock{
font-size:18px;
color:#ffffff;
text-align:left;
}

.flex_column.av-91fs45e-43ded724642e91b2f8e593103fecac04{
border-radius:30px 30px 30px 30px;
padding:3% 3% 3% 3%;
}
.avia_transform .flex_column.av-91fs45e-43ded724642e91b2f8e593103fecac04{
animation-duration:2.5s;
}

.flex_column.av-t87nky-84734ef637cfcfc45969b36843363522{
border-radius:30px 30px 30px 30px;
padding:3% 3% 3% 3%;
background-color:rgba(120,120,120,0.43);
}
.avia_transform .flex_column.av-t87nky-84734ef637cfcfc45969b36843363522{
animation-duration:2.5s;
}

#top .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1{
padding-bottom:10px;
color:#ffffff;
font-size:40px;
}
body .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-special-heading-tag{
font-size:40px;
}
.av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.special-heading-inner-border{
border-color:#ffffff;
}
.av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-70i6ide-7b82863a13419ecfad2c548cdf87dadf .avia_textblock{
font-size:16px;
color:#ffffff;
text-align:left;
}

.flex_column.av-6hfyaiq-3d6bc187324eda7798fea1784708cb80{
border-radius:30px 30px 30px 30px;
padding:3% 3% 3% 3%;
}
.avia_transform .flex_column.av-6hfyaiq-3d6bc187324eda7798fea1784708cb80{
animation-duration:2.5s;
}

#top .av-special-heading.av-5fb4zuq-7d3f65594da9378a0c5e54990b384257{
padding-bottom:0;
font-size:40px;
}
body .av-special-heading.av-5fb4zuq-7d3f65594da9378a0c5e54990b384257 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-5fb4zuq-7d3f65594da9378a0c5e54990b384257 .av-special-heading-tag{
font-size:40px;
}
.av-special-heading.av-5fb4zuq-7d3f65594da9378a0c5e54990b384257 .av-subheading{
font-size:15px;
}

.flex_cell.av-4blxy76-e91d7ecceb4849099694c7062a42a37e{
vertical-align:middle;
background-color:#eaeaed;
}
.responsive #top #wrap_all .flex_cell.av-4blxy76-e91d7ecceb4849099694c7062a42a37e{
padding:4% 8% 3% 8% !important;
}

.flex_column.av-3vsxzcy-04caeebee519db5133de9c6fb964c8ec{
width:32%;
margin-left:0;
padding:0% 0% 0% 0%;
}
#top .flex_column_table.av-equal-height-column-flextable.av-3vsxzcy-04caeebee519db5133de9c6fb964c8ec .av-flex-placeholder{
width:2%;
}

#top .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431{
margin:0% 0% 0% 0%;
padding-bottom:0%;
color:#2a5893;
font-size:40px;
}
body .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-special-heading-tag{
font-size:40px;
padding:0% 0% 0% 0%;
}
.av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.special-heading-inner-border{
border-color:#2a5893;
}
.av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-subheading{
font-size:15px;
}

#top .av_textblock_section.av-30ot1tu-dd39d73038c0a1f97e0081ddec23e740 .avia_textblock{
font-size:18px;
}

.flex_column.av-2lrf77m-f876292354e745c11583660e68a0413e{
width:66%;
margin-left:0;
padding:0% 0% 0% 0%;
}
#top .flex_column_table.av-equal-height-column-flextable.av-2lrf77m-f876292354e745c11583660e68a0413e .av-flex-placeholder{
width:2%;
}


@media only screen and (min-width: 990px){ 
.flex_column.av-a9zllj6-a738127c7fb3dbb64133822eee63c14d{
padding:4% 3% 4% 3%;
}

#top #wrap_all .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-special-heading-tag{
font-size:45px;
}

#top #wrap_all .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-special-heading-tag{
font-size:35px;
}

#top #wrap_all .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-special-heading-tag{
font-size:40px;
}

#top .av_textblock_section.av-30ot1tu-dd39d73038c0a1f97e0081ddec23e740 .avia_textblock{
font-size:18px;
}
}

@media only screen and (min-width: 768px) and (max-width: 989px){ 
.flex_column.av-a9zllj6-a738127c7fb3dbb64133822eee63c14d{
padding:3% 3% 3% 3%;
}

#top #wrap_all .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-special-heading-tag{
font-size:35px;
}

#top #wrap_all .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-special-heading-tag{
font-size:35px;
}

#top #wrap_all .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-special-heading-tag{
font-size:34px;
}

#top .av_textblock_section.av-30ot1tu-dd39d73038c0a1f97e0081ddec23e740 .avia_textblock{
font-size:16px;
}
}

@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-doaotuq-0d795f8d14ca077c9ea76c677c4d693b .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-bl8n602-3a7087f89e59e508e882631d7349b89b .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-special-heading-tag{
font-size:32px;
}

#top #wrap_all .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-special-heading-tag{
font-size:32px;
}

#top #wrap_all .av-special-heading.av-5fb4zuq-7d3f65594da9378a0c5e54990b384257 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-special-heading-tag{
font-size:28px;
}

#top .av_textblock_section.av-30ot1tu-dd39d73038c0a1f97e0081ddec23e740 .avia_textblock{
font-size:14px;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-mhijsyxz-0f1938c8d6e395d1e791ff2e18118922 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-doaotuq-0d795f8d14ca077c9ea76c677c4d693b .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-bl8n602-3a7087f89e59e508e882631d7349b89b .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-a0p6f1e-6e43e8fee16161c3208ef5a7deb3f192 .av-special-heading-tag{
font-size:32px;
}

#top #wrap_all .av-special-heading.av-7s7dfhe-5bfc2e0cca9ba8bf726170ad8a6009d1 .av-special-heading-tag{
font-size:32px;
}

#top #wrap_all .av-special-heading.av-5fb4zuq-7d3f65594da9378a0c5e54990b384257 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-3dd7y6a-92a34815b3e7791bb472ab0ede9fd431 .av-special-heading-tag{
font-size:22px;
}

#top .av_textblock_section.av-30ot1tu-dd39d73038c0a1f97e0081ddec23e740 .avia_textblock{
font-size:12px;
}
}
